This position reports to the Superintendent of the Water Reclamation Facility. Will assist in the operation of the Water Reclamation Facility.
- Collects samples for testing and analysis in primary and secondary treatment areas.
- Delegates to subordinates to prioritize duties in the treatment plant
- Operates and maintains treatment equipment and observes the operation of related plant equipment.
- Reads gauges, records information and reports problems to the Chief Operator, or Superintendent.
- Performs janitorial and grounds keeping duties in assigned areas.
- Troubleshoot mechanical issues with varying difficulty levels
- Performs related duties as assigned.
Ability to sit, stand and transport self from building to building. Ability to drive a vehicle to and from various work sites. Employee will work in seasonal temperatures bending, lifting, kneeling, twisting, and climbing to operate and maintain plant equipment. Employee can work with potential mechanical, chemical and electrical hazards while collecting samples. Employee may be exposed to communicable diseases while handling raw sewage.
Required QualificationsAbility to effectively communicate with employees and supervisors on plant condition and receive work orders or instructions for any project.
Ability to read and comprehend operator's manuals, gauges, and work orders. Ability to have attention-to-detail when collecting samples for analysis. Skilled in writing legibly to record results. 12-hr shift work required.
High school diploma or equivalent required. Must have valid Texas Driver's License. Wastewater Class C license from TCEQ is required.
